Abstract


Abstract: The research objectives to be achieved are: Describe the activities of teachers and students in the Civics learning process based on cooperative learning type role-playing approach. Describing an increase in Civics learning outcomes in class III of SD Negeri 3 Mojoagung through a cooperative learning model of roleplaying
type. The subject of the study was the third-grade students of the first semester of the 2015/2016 academic year. Place of implementation of learning improvements in SD Negeri 3 Mojoagung, Karangrayung District, Grobogan Regency. The implementation of learning improvements is carried out in two stages: a.
Precycle on Wednesday, August 16, 2016. b. Cycle I on Wednesday, September 6, 2016. c. Cycle II on Art day, October 02, 2016. Research Procedure: The implementation of learning begins with the initial learning. The implementation is carried out three times, namely early learning (pre-cycle), the cycle I, and cycle II. Each consists of planning, implementing, observing, and reflecting. and the results of reflection in cycle II are: Almost all students are actively involved in role-playing. In group discussions, almost all students are active and good cooperation is created in completing tasks. Learning evaluation results have been good although there is still one student whose grades are below the KKM. But the average score is above the KKM, which is 90 and the level of completeness is 96%. Thus the improvement of Civics learning in class III in the first semester at SD Negeri 3 Mojoagung, Karangrayung Subdistrict, Grobogan District through cooperative learning through the model of role-playing is considered sufficient. This is evidenced by an increase in learning outcomes or the results of the evaluation of the average value above KKM which is 80 and 96% completeness
